The numeral 1 in the style number represents the size, standard size. It's currently strung with light guage silk and steel strings. The serial number places the guitar at around 1897. Back is scalloped ladder braced, and top has a scalloped diagonal brace across running under bridge. When found, tailpiece, pictured, was used, and was tied to end strap button. I believe this guitar is all original, including unusual bridge which has factory drilled string holes through base, that are recessed (counter-sunk) on fretboard side. Bridge is either ebony or stained fruitwood. Numerous scratches and a few small dings. Antique Lyon & Healy "Jupiter" parlor guitar with spruce top and birch or maple back & sides.
